| Synopsis: |
A sketch show featuring a wide range of characters, most of whom are played by Lucas and Walliams. The characters include incoherent teenager Vicky Pollard, lazy Andy and his too generous friend Andy, Emily Howard the unconvincing transvestite, Welsh Dafydd the only gay in the village, Fat Fighter Marjorie Dawes, romantic writer Dame Sally Markham and the repulsively obese Bubbles.

| BSG Review: |
Ask anyone what they think of "Little Britain" and the reply is always the same - it's fantastic and, in the words of Ms Pollard, "like, sooooo funny!".
Lucas and Walliams show an impressively wide range of acting skills playing a large and diverse set of memorable characters - many of whom after just one series embedded themselves into popular culture.
That said, the last specials (shown Christmas 2006) were poor. Lazy writing and not as sharp or as funny as they should have been. |
